1. New Features
• Support for Two Factor Authentication. Two Factor Authentication enables a site to strengthen
access to selected doors by requiring the cardholder to approve the access request on their
mobile device, thereby assuring the access request is being made by the rightful owner of the
credential. Supported with C•CURE 9000 v2.70 SP3 and higher (future release).
• Provides the choice to enforce TLSv1.2 (stronger security) which disables TLSv1.0 and TLSv1.1.
The iSTAR Diagnostic Utility contains a new checkbox to enforce TLSv1.2. The iSTAR Edge and
iSTAR eX members must be running firmware version 6.x.x or higher.
To access the iSTAR Edge/eX Diagnostic Utility:
1. Open the iSTAR Edge/eX Diagnostic Utility. (Enter the IP address in a browser using the
format https://10.10.10.10.)
2. Under Diagnostics, click SID Diagnostic Levels.
3. Select the TLSv1.2 check box.
4. Click Submit.

2. Limitations
• All iSTAR Edge’s and iSTAR eX’s in a cluster must be at version 6.x.x and higher to communicate
within the cluster and with the host.
• Diagnostic levels (SID, Reader, and I/O) are not supported on the iSTAR Edge and iSTAR eX if
using Internet Explorer 11, unless Compatibility mode is enabled.

• iSTAR Edge/eX as members in clusters with an iSTAR Ultra as the master. To use TLS1.2 only
(stronger security) for the connection between the iSTAR Ultra master and other encrypted
iSTAR Edge’s and iSTAR eX’s, there is a new check box on the iSTAR Ultra Web General page
which takes effect after panel reboot. The iSTAR Edge/eX must first be upgraded to firmware
v6.x.x.
To access the iSTAR Ultra/Ultra SE General page with the new check box:
1. Open the iSTAR Ultra Web page of the Ultra/Ultra SE Master controller. (Enter the IP
address in a browser using the format https://10.10.10.10.)
2. Enter the username and password.
3. Click Configure.
4. Select Settings and click General.
5. Select the TLSv1.2 for Cluster Encryption (Edge/eX member must be running 6.x.x
or newer FW) check box to enable TLS1.2.

3. SPARs Fixed
417825 – Added support for Two Factor Authentication. See New Features.
417844 – Resolved a case where events activated to demuster and clear counts weren’t being cleared or
downloaded to the controller.
460540 – Bad PIN Reader Disable Status now displays properly in the Monitoring Station and in the
Journal.
541733 – Resolved a case where events were not displaying proper activate and deactivate status.
553696 – Resolved an HTTPS Web page vulnerability. See New Features “Support for TLSv1.2 (stronger
security)”.
567894 – Resolved a case where the Event Manager became unresponsive and did not retain
configuration after a power loss with no connection to the host.

Determining iSTAR Controller Types
There are two ways to determine the iSTAR controller type:
1. From the C•CURE 9000 Monitoring Station, select Hardware Status and then iSTAR Controllers from
the context menu to access the iSTAR Controllers Status dialog box. In the status box, scroll to the
column called Controller Type (C•CURE 9000) or Board Type (C•CURE 800/8000) to display the type
of board.
2. From the ICU, select Tools and then Controller Status from the context menu to access "Controller
Status."
3. The Board Type/Board column displays IV for iSTAR Edge and III for the iSTAR eX.

5. Upgrading the iSTAR Firmware


The iSTAR Controller must be communicating properly for the new firmware version to install and run
properly.
1. To upgrade the iSTAR firmware, copy the firmware files:
• For C•CURE 9000:
C:\Program Files(x86)\Tyco\CrossFire\ServerComponents\istar\ICU\firmware

• C•CURE 800/8000:
%CC800ROOT%\BIN\FLASH

• For ICU, in the ICU/Firmware folder.


2. Initiate Firmware Flash from the Monitoring Station, C•CURE 9000, or the ICU following the
instructions or help released with those products.
IMPORTANT: If you are using ICU v6.6.5 or later, the ICU must be restarted anytime an iSTAR
Edge, or iSTAR eX, panel boots to the last known good boot image to be able to download a new
firmware image. The ICU must be used to download the firmware image.
